The Power of Practicing Silence: How Embracing Stillness Transforms Mind and Life
The Need for Silence in a Noisy World
In a world full of constant chatter, the art of silence often seems lost. We are surrounded by the hum of technology, social media notifications, and endless conversations. Yet, practicing silence is more than just avoiding noise; it is about cultivating inner peace, clarity, and understanding. The need for silence has never been greater, as it offers a sanctuary from the overwhelming demands of modern life.
In this blog, we will explore the benefits of practicing silence, why it is essential, and how to make it a part of your daily routine for a more peaceful and meaningful life.
What Does Practicing Silence Mean?
Practicing silence goes beyond simply staying quiet. It is a deliberate choice to tune out external distractions and focus inwardly. Silence can be observed in many forms—whether it’s in meditation, mindfulness, or even during moments of reflection.
Silence helps you listen better, not just to others, but to your own thoughts and feelings. It is about creating space for self-awareness, deeper thinking, and emotional balance. It is about being fully present in the moment without the pressure to speak or react.
Why Silence Matters
Improved Mental ClarityOne of the most immediate benefits of practicing silence is the clarity it brings to your mind. When the noise of daily life fades, you gain the ability to focus on what truly matters. Silence allows the mind to declutter, revealing insights that might have been buried under the hustle and bustle.
Emotional BalanceIn silence, emotions have a space to surface without judgment. When we stop to listen to our feelings without external distractions, we can process emotions more effectively. It’s a powerful way to reduce stress, anxiety, and even anger. Practicing silence helps you gain emotional balance, making it easier to respond rather than react impulsively.
Enhanced CreativityCreativity thrives in silence. Without constant interruptions, the mind is free to wander, explore ideas, and think outside the box. Some of the greatest thinkers and artists of history, like Einstein and Picasso, credited silence and solitude as crucial to their creative process. By practicing silence, you give your brain the opportunity to rest and recharge, leading to greater creativity.
Strengthened RelationshipsSilence can improve your relationships by enhancing your ability to listen. Often, in conversations, we are focused on responding rather than truly hearing the other person. Practicing silence teaches patience, encouraging you to listen more deeply and communicate more effectively. This leads to deeper connections and more meaningful relationships.
How to Practice Silence in Daily Life
You don’t need to retreat to a monastery to embrace silence. It’s possible to practice silence in small, intentional ways each day.
Morning Quiet TimeStart your day with silence. Rather than reaching for your phone or turning on the TV, spend the first few minutes after waking up in quiet contemplation. This sets a calm tone for the day and helps you gather your thoughts before the world’s demands start pulling you in different directions.
Mindful MeditationMeditation is a powerful tool for practicing silence. It involves focusing on your breath and quieting the mind. Regular meditation, even for just 10 minutes a day, can greatly improve your ability to stay calm, focused, and centered.
Silent Walks in NatureTake time to walk in nature without any distractions. Leave your phone behind and immerse yourself in the sights and sounds around you. A walk in silence can be incredibly restorative, helping you connect with yourself and the world in a deeper way.
Digital DetoxOne of the greatest sources of noise today is our digital devices. Set aside time each day to disconnect from social media, emails, and constant notifications. Use this time to be present, think, and reflect without the distraction of technology.
Silent Reflection Before BedEnd your day with a moment of silence. Before falling asleep, reflect on the day’s events without speaking or engaging in any activities. This helps your mind unwind and prepares you for a restful night.
The Spiritual Dimension of Silence
For many, practicing silence is a spiritual experience. Silence is often associated with deeper states of awareness, introspection, and connection with the universe or a higher power. Religious and spiritual traditions throughout history, from Buddhism to Christianity, have emphasized the value of silence in the pursuit of enlightenment and inner peace.
In moments of silence, we can connect with something greater than ourselves, whether that be a sense of purpose, nature, or a higher spiritual truth. Silence allows us to explore the mysteries of life, offering a space for reflection on our purpose and place in the world.
Challenges of Practicing Silence
Despite its benefits, practicing silence can be challenging in today’s fast-paced world. The constant stimulation from social media, work, and family can make it difficult to find quiet moments. Additionally, many people find silence uncomfortable at first, as it forces them to confront their inner thoughts and emotions.
However, like any skill, practicing silence gets easier with time. The key is to start small—integrate short periods of silence into your daily routine and gradually increase the duration as it becomes more comfortable.
Conclusion: Embrace Silence for a Fuller Life
Practicing silence is a powerful tool for personal growth, emotional well-being, and creativity. In a world that never seems to stop, silence offers a chance to pause, reflect, and reconnect with what truly matters. By incorporating silence into your life, you can cultivate a sense of calm, clarity, and deeper understanding—both of yourself and the world around you.
The next time life feels overwhelming, remember that peace is just a moment of silence away. Embrace the stillness, and allow the power of practicing silence to transform your mind, body, and spirit.

Salam. I am an infj Muslim. And I have a hard time keeping to routines. Sadly salat is one of them. Any advice on how to keep myself longing for salat over again. Because I never keep to routine for more that two weeks
Walaikum asalaam wrwb fellow INFJ muslim! Sorry to hear about your difficulty with routines, may Allah swt make it easy for you, and reward your intention to keep up with and improve your prayers, ameen.
That’s a brilliant question. Salah is one of the 5 pillars ofIslam, and in order to strengthen our relationship with Allah swt it’s vital that we establish our prayer on time and pray with khushoo (attentiveness).
Here are some tips I have found useful in establishing prayer andmake yourself long for each prayer:
1.   Make an intention to pray all your salahs on time, and with khushoo. Make dua to Allah swt to make it easy for you to worship Him in a way He is most pleased with. Then follow the next steps…
2.   Prioritise your daily tasks around your prayers. One way you can remind yourself of the prayer times for your location is by downloading a prayer times app. Then add the prayer times widget to your phone home screen. Now every time you turn on your phone you’ll see exactly when you need to pray your salah, and you can even get notifications when each prayer timestarts. If you struggle with fajir, set multiple alarms for times before or after fajir starts. If you wake up or are awake before fajir time, pray tahajud to further strengthen your iman and make dua to Allah.
3.   If you ever feel unmotivated, remember this Hadith: Abu Hurairah, radiyallahu ‘anhu, reported that the Messenger of Allah, sallallahu ‘alayhi wasallam, said : “On every person’s joints or small bones(i.e. fingers and toes), there is sadaqah (charity) every day the sun rises.Doing justice between two people is sadaqah; assisting a man to mount his animal, orlifting up his belongings onto it is sadaqah; a good word is sadaqah; every step you take towards prayer is sadaqah; and removing harmful things from pathwaysis sadaqah.” [Al-Bukhari& Muslim]
4.   Pray in a quiet, clean place, free from distractions. Remember Allah swt inyour heart before you begin your prayer, try and free your mind of any worldly thoughts or priorities. If you find your mind usually wanders during salah, then pleasefollow the advice of this Hadith.  It also helps to say aaoothu billahi minashShaytaan ar-rajeem before reciting any Quran in your salah.
5.   Learn the meaning of everything that we read in each prayer and take time to remember it during your prayer. For example, when you recite each part of your prayer (SubhanakAllahumma..,Surah Fatiha, any surah, subhana rabbiyalazeem etc.) remember the meaning of it in your own language in your head during or after you recite it in Arabic. Read the meaning of what you read in prayer here on pg 23 onwards.
6.  Engage deeply with Allah’s words. On my Islamic course, they taught us that when you read the words of the Quran, remember there are 3 ways of engaging with Allah’s words. The lowest is 1) reciting it as if you are reading it to Allah swt, medium level is: 2) reciting it as if you are reading it to Allah swt and you area ware He swt is looking at you with Mercy, and the best way to engage is by 3) Recognising that the Quran is the Kalaam (Noble Speech) of Allah swt, your Creator, and the very words you are reciting. Allah’s speech is a part of His attributes, and the fact that we can even recite words which can hold His speech is a Mercy and this allows us to experience His intimacy. Another thing you can do whilst praying is imagine jannah on your right, hellfire on yourleft, and you crossing As-Sirat.  
7.   Treat each prayer as a chance to have a conversation with Allahswt. How? By reciting some Sunnah duas when you go in to sujood after reading ‘subhana rabbial Al’aa’ 3 times (minimum). I find it easier to make an album onmy phone and download dua images I find online into it to memorise them and use in sujood especially.
8.   Make dhikr & dua after each prayer. After each prayer, praise Allah swt, send durood on the prophet pbuh and then make your most heartfelt duas (please do keep the entire ummah in your duas). Use any of the relevant 99 names of Allah swt to your situation (e.g. Ash-Shafi (The Healer), please heal me) and pour your heart out to Him. Never be short in your duas, He swt can make the impossible, possible. After that seek Allah’s protection by reading ayahtul kursi and the 3 quls and blowing it on your hands and rubbing over your body, as the Prophet pbuh would do.
As an INFJ, I can vouch that tips 5- 8 have especially helped meimmensely in gaining khushoo. Also in your spare time, reading the tafsir of the verses we recite in prayer is like gold mine for increasing attentiveness and a deeper understanding of the amazing words of our Creator swt. FreeQuranEducation offers lots of tafsir, Arabic and general advice videos that make it easy, visual and digestible.
In terms of other routines, I actually don’t naturally follow a strict detailed daily routine (which is probably more satisfying to higher Si users like my sister and my dad). Instead, I often focus on my main priorities for each day (or week/month if it’s an ongoing project), and work on the most timely and important tasks first. Remember to trust your gut instincts (Ni) when setting tasks. If you feel you are making a mistake by prioritising one thingover another on your list at this moment in time, then follow your gut feeling and change it! I would also advise to try and work on each task *well* before each deadline, so that you can keep yourself calm and use your Se to adapt to change as and when needed - life always has its way of introducing new delays or urgent priorities lol
Hope this helps, inshaAllah.
